在当今数字化转型迅速发展的时代,区块链技术凭借其去中心化、不可篡改和透明性等特点,广泛应用于金融、供应链管理、身份认证等多个领域。作为领先的云计算和人工智能服务提供商,阿里云也推出了其区块链平台,旨在帮助企业快速构建区块链应用。本文将详细介绍如何对接阿里云区块链平台,并深入探讨这一过程中可能遇到的问题和解决方案。
阿里云区块链平台,是阿里巴巴集团旗下的云计算服务平台,专门为企业用户提供区块链解决方案。它依托于阿里云强大的云计算资源和安全体系,帮助企业快速部署、管理区块链应用。该平台支持多种区块链网络,如Hyperledger Fabric和公链等,满足不同业务场景的需求。通过阿里云区块链平台,企业可以实现数据的高效共享、交易的可靠性保障以及信息的安全存储。
对接阿里云区块链平台的第一步,是确保您已拥有阿里云账号,并具备足够的权限管理区块链服务。接下来,您需要遵循以下步骤进行平台的对接:
1. **创建区块链网络**:登录阿里云管理控制台,选择区块链服务(BaaS)选项,点击“创建网络”。根据实际需求选择网络的类型(如联盟链或公链),并按照提示配置相关参数,包括网络名称、节点规格等。
2. **配置节点**:建立网络后,您需要配置区块链节点。阿里云允许您根据业务需求选择节点的数量和规格。节点的配置对于区块链的处理能力和可靠性至关重要。
3. **开发智能合约**:智能合约是区块链应用的核心逻辑,您可以使用 Solidity 或其他合约语言编写合约代码。阿里云区块链平台提供了丰富的开发文档和示例,帮助您快速上手。
4. **部署智能合约**:通过阿里云的管理控制台,将编写好的智能合约进行上传和部署。在这一过程中,您需要检查合约逻辑是否存在问题,并确保合约能够正确执行。
5. **调用API接口**:部署完成后,您可以通过提供的API接口与区块链进行交互。阿里云提供了RESTful API接口,使得与区块链的交互变得更加简单和高效。您可以在应用中直接调用这些接口,进行数据的写入和读取。
6. **监控与运维**:在应用上线后,您需要对区块链网络进行实时监控和维护。阿里云提供了监控工具,帮助您及时发现和解决可能出现的问题,保证系统的稳定运行。
在对接阿里云区块链平台的过程中,可能会面临许多挑战,以下是一些主要的挑战及对应的解决方案:
对许多企业而言,区块链技术仍然是一个相对新颖的领域。缺乏技术储备和专业人才,可能会导致在开发和部署过程中的困难。
解决方案:企业可以通过与阿里云的技术支持团队合作,获取专业的指导和支持。同时,阿里云也提供了丰富的培训课程和文档,帮助企业提升相关的技术能力。企业还可以考虑招聘或外包区块链开发者、架构师等专业技术人才,以确保项目的顺利推进。
区块链的应用涉及大量数据的处理及传输,尤其是在金融等高度监管的行业。合规性问题必须引起重视。
解决方案:企业应在项目启动前做好法律法规的调研,了解行业相关的合规要求。从数据隐私保护、交易透明度到用户身份认证等方面,确保每一个环节都符合相关法规要求。此外,利用阿里云的合规服务,可以帮助企业更好地应对监管挑战。阿里云提供的安全合规等服务,可以帮助企业在合规的同时,保障数据的安全。
区块链网络的性能和吞吐量是影响应用体验的重要因素。企业在进行大规模交易时,可能会遭遇性能瓶颈。
解决方案:在对接过程中,企业应合理配置区块链网络的资源,包括节点的选择和数量。同时,智能合约的设计,提升合约的执行效率。此外,阿里云也提供了先进的负载均衡技术,帮助企业提高系统的处理能力,应对突发流量。
区块链技术的推广和应用,需要用户的理解和接受。如果用户对区块链的认知不足,可能会影响应用的推广效果。
解决方案:企业需要在应用上线前进行广泛的宣传和教育,通过公众培训、研讨会等形式提高用户对区块链的认知。同时,提供良好的用户体验和服务,确保用户可以轻松上手使用区块链应用,以增强用户的接受度。
对接阿里云区块链平台是企业数字化转型的重要一步,但在这个过程中面临的挑战也不容忽视。通过充分利用阿里云的技术支持与服务、加强团队的专业能力建设,并注重合规与用户体验,企业可以更顺利地完成区块链应用的落地和实施,实现业务的创新与可持续发展。随着区块链技术的不断成熟,未来更多的企业将加入到这一浪潮中,以实现更高效的数字化转型。
2003-2026 tp官方下载安卓最新版本2026 @版权所有 |网站地图|浙ICP备2024112407号